90. How experiences settle in the body and strengthen us as human beings

Why is it that some people you meet or see feel very secure, confident, and self-assured, while others feel insecure or have a strange aura?

Experience-based knowledge is something everyone has to some degree, something anyone can acquire, and something those secure, confident people have in abundance.

But how is it that you know how to do something once you know how to do it – like riding a bike or reading, what does it mean to be comfortable in your own body, and why do we value theoretical knowledge so much more than knowledge based on experience?

Participants in the episode are Axel Bohlin, Hans Bohlin, and Per Johansson.
